How courts have described this case
Verbatim parenthetical descriptions written by other courts when citing this decision. Ranked by citation-network relevance.
- noting that “[i]nfliction of a burn on the patient’s buttocks is not a normal or usual result” from surgery for correction of a vascular circulatory problem “if due care is exercised in the performance of the operation”
- unusual injury to a healthy part of the body not within the area of surgery
- patient came out of vascular operation with a part of his body burned that was not within the area of the operation
- vascular operation — burned buttocks; “Knowledge and experience teaches us that in the ordinary course of events one undergoing surgery does not sustain an unusual injury to a healthy part of his body not within the area of the operation in the absence of negligence.”
- discussing Rule 1.721-1.729, Iowa R. Civ. P.
